用儿童语音语境提升亲子对话识别准确率
Context-aware child-directed speech detection from long-form recordings
- 基于儿童语音数据微调自监督模型,效果优于通用语音模型
- 引入上下文信息使平均F1提升13.8个百分点
- 在真实端到端流程中仍优于传统规则方法,适合多语言研究
在长时录音中自动区分亲子对话与成人对话,是实现儿童语言环境规模化分析的关键。现有方法通常孤立处理话语片段,且主要在英语数据上评估。本文从三个维度弥补这些不足:首先,在包含182名儿童的多语言数据集上对六种自监督模型进行微调与评估,结果表明在以儿童为中心的录音上进行领域内预训练,显著优于在成人语音上训练的模型;其次,引入相邻语境信息可显著提升分类性能,平均F1得分绝对提升13.8%;第三,将模型置于从成人语音检测到对话对象分类的完整端到端流程中评估,尽管自动分段导致性能下降,但整体仍持续优于规则基线。
原文摘要 · Abstract (English)
Automatically distinguishing child-directed speech from adult-directed speech in long-form recordings is key to scalable analyses of children's language environments. Existing approaches process utterances in isolation and have been evaluated primarily on English. We address these gaps along three dimensions. First, we fine-tune and evaluate six-self supervised models on a multilingual dataset of 182 children, showing that in-domain pre-training on child-centered recordings substantially outperforms models trained on adult speech. Second, we demonstrate that incorporating surrounding context substantially improves classification, with an absolute gain of 13.8% in average F1-score. Third, we evaluate our model in a realistic end-to-end pipeline, from adult speech detection to addressee classification, showing that performance drops under automatic segmentation but still consistently outperforms a rule-based baseline.
